1. Click the Settings icon | select More Settings. 2. Click Filters. 3. Click Add new filters. 4. Enter the filter name, set the filter rules, and choose or create a folder for the emails. 5. Click Save.
Organize your email messages by putting them into folders where they're easy to locate. You can move emails from your inbox into a folder or move them from one folder to another. 1. Select the emails you want to move. 2. Click Move. 3. Select the folder where you want the email to go.

Use the sorting feature regardless of the folder you are in to rearrange the emails and find the ones important, click on Sort on top right of your emails list and choose the option that best suits your need. • Date - Newest on top. • Date - Oldest on top. • Unread - Lists your unread emails on top. • Read - Lists your read emails on top.
